    I'm pretty sure he considered it his "home track" ... from what I've read, Liberman started his drag racing career in 1964 driving his "HERCULES" Nova:

    Jim Liberman and his 'HERCULES' Chevy Nova (Mike Goyda collection).jpg

    ... in the Stock division @ Fremont Raceway ... and he switched to Funny Cars in 1965.

    It is important that we remember the value of "showmanship" as part of a race team's performance package... Too often these days, the idea of "wowing the crowd" has become neglected by a majority of "modern" compe***ors... The success of the "Jungle" Jim and "Jungle" Pam team was largely due to not only being concerned with having a well tuned machine, but also creating a "visual presentation" that captures the hearts and imagination of the paying fans seated in the grandstands...
